Ingredients
To create a delicious pot of homestyle egg drop soup, you will need the following ingredients:
– Chicken or vegetable broth
– Eggs
– Cornstarch
– Soy sauce
– Sesame oil
– Salt and pepper
– Green onions (optional for garnish)
Feel free to explore different variations by adding ingredients like tofu, mushrooms, or spinach to suit your taste preferences. The beauty of this recipe lies in its adaptability, so don’t hesitate to get creative with your choices!
Step-by-Step Instructions
1. In a saucepan, heat the chicken or vegetable broth over medium heat until it simmers gently.
2. In a small bowl, whisk together the eggs, cornstarch, soy sauce, sesame oil, salt, and pepper until well combined.
3. Slowly pour the egg mixture into the simmering broth while stirring gently with a fork or chopsticks to create delicate egg ribbons.
4. Continue to cook for another minute until the eggs are set but still tender.
5. Taste the soup and adjust the seasoning if needed. Add more salt, pepper, or soy sauce according to your preference.
6. Ladle the hot soup into bowls, garnish with chopped green onions if desired, and serve immediately.

Expert Tips for Success
For the best results when making egg drop soup, consider the following tips:
– Use homemade broth or high-quality store-bought broth for a rich and flavorful base.
– Gradually pour the egg mixture into the broth in a steady stream to achieve thin, wispy egg strands.
– Avoid stirring the soup vigorously once you add the eggs to maintain the desired texture.
– Experiment with different seasonings such as ginger, garlic, or chili flakes to add depth to the soup’s flavor profile.

Variations and Substitutions
If you’re looking to switch up the traditional egg drop soup recipe, consider trying these creative variations:
– Add diced tofu or shredded chicken for extra protein and texture.
– Incorporate vegetables like mushrooms, bok choy, or peas to enhance the nutritional value of the soup.
– Replace the soy sauce with tamari for a gluten-free alternative or with fish sauce for a unique umami flavor.

FAQs
Q: Can I make egg drop soup in advance?
A: While egg drop soup is best enjoyed fresh, you can prepare the broth ahead of time and add the eggs just before serving to maintain their delicate texture.
Q: How can I make egg drop soup thicker?
A: To thicken the soup, you can increase the amount of cornstarch in the egg mixture or simmer the broth for a longer period to reduce and concentrate the flavors.
Q: Is egg drop soup healthy?
A: Egg drop soup can be a nutritious choice, especially when made with wholesome ingredients like homemade broth and fresh eggs. It’s low in calories and can be a good source of protein and essential nutrients.
Q: Can I freeze leftover egg drop soup?
A: While egg drop soup is best enjoyed fresh, you can freeze any leftovers in an airtight container for up to a month. Thaw and reheat gently on the stovetop, adding a splash of broth if needed to restore the soup’s consistency.

Homestyle Egg Drop Soup
Experience the magic of homestyle egg drop soup with its velvety texture, delicate flavors, and comforting warmth. This beloved dish is a joy to prepare and a delight to savor, perfect for any occasion.
Ingredients
- 4 cups chicken or vegetable broth
- 4 eggs
- 2 tablespoons cornstarch
- 2 tablespoons soy sauce
- 1 teaspoon sesame oil
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Green onions for garnish (optional)
Directions
- In a saucepan, heat the chicken or vegetable broth over medium heat until it simmers gently.
- In a small bowl, whisk together the eggs, cornstarch, soy sauce, sesame oil, salt, and pepper until well combined.
- Slowly pour the egg mixture into the simmering broth while stirring gently to create delicate egg ribbons.
- Cook for another minute until the eggs are set but still tender.
- Adjust seasoning if needed with more salt, pepper, or soy sauce.
- Ladle the hot soup into bowls, garnish with chopped green onions if desired, and serve immediately.
